آرد
Persian
Alternative forms
- آرت (ârt) (regional)
Etymology
From Middle Persian KHMA (ārd, “flour”), ultimately from Proto-Indo-European. Cognate with Avestan 𐬀𐬴𐬀 (aṣ̌a, “ground”) and Old Armenian աղամ (ałam).
